Karnataka Forms Cabinet Sub-Committee to Address Student Issues and Education Reforms

The Karnataka government has formed a five-member Cabinet sub-committee, chaired by Health Minister U T Khader, to address student issues and recommend education reforms. The panel will examine examination integrity, recruitment transparency, education costs, infrastructure, curriculum, skilling, and mental health. It includes ministers Basavaraj Rayareddy, Priyank Kharge, Sharan Prakash Patil, and Madhu Bangarappa, and is tasked with submitting recommendations within one month to improve education quality and student welfare across the state.
